I am finishing mine as well. I noticed your brake servo setup. What type of arm/spring setup is that? It looks perfect. I used the stock Savage X SS setup and the servo arm really isn't long enough and I don't have room to use a spring.
Yea I found the same thing with the stock brake arm/linkage setup. I would love to see the servo mount plate a little wider and have the servo offset closer to the side for the brake. It would let you use the stock servo arm then. This is what I used. http://www.horizonhobby.com/Products...ProdID=JRPA236
with this for the slider linkage
http://www3.towerhobbies.com/cgi-bin...?&I=LXNXL5&P=7
The actual connecting rods in the linkage are the stock ones and the little aluminum piece holding it all on the end of the rod is just a standard collar with a grub screw that came off of a old nitro brake assembly I ripped off of something when it was converted to electric.

I actually had all of these parts just sitting around in a parts bin left over from some other project where they didnt work out, but yes they did work out well for the arm length just by luck.
